Will Gold Shine in 2024?

As the upcoming year looms on the horizon, investors and analysts alike are eagerly examining the future trajectory of gold. The precious metal has historically served as a safe haven during times of economic uncertainty, but will it continue to prosper in 2024?

Several factors could influence gold's value. Global inflation remains a major concern, potentially pushing demand for gold as an inflation mitigator. Additionally, geopolitical uncertainties could also fuel a flight to safety, favoring gold.

However, opposing forces such as rising interest rates and a strengthening US dollar could counteract gold's appeal.

Ultimately, predicting gold's future with absolute certainty is an challenging task. The coming year will likely bring a fluctuating landscape for the precious metal, with its price potentially wavering sideways.

Gold Market Outlook: Unveiling Drivers and Signals

The trajectory of gold prices fluctuates significantly, influenced by a intricate interplay of fundamental drivers and technical indicators. Fundamental analysis delves into macroeconomic factors such as inflation, geopolitical tensions, and investor sentiment. Rising inflation often stimulates demand for gold as a hedge against decline in purchasing power. Conversely, healthy economic growth and soaring interest rates can depress gold's lure as investors seek higher returns in other assets.

Technical indicators, on the other hand, analyze historical price patterns and trading volume to identify potential future movements. Common indicators include moving averages, relative strength index (RSI), and MACD, which can indicate buy or sell opportunities based on momentum and price trends.

While fundamental analysis provides a broader context for understanding gold's value, technical indicators offer more precise insights into short-term shifts. Seasoned traders often utilize a combination of both approaches to make educated trading decisions in the dynamic gold market.

Plunging in Gold: Is It a Safe Haven in Uncertain Times?

When global fundamentals are volatile and uncertainty hangs heavy, many investors turn to gold as a potential safe haven. The yellow metal has historically maintained here its value during periods of economic turmoil, making it an appealing investment option for those seeking to protect their wealth. Gold's intrinsic worth and finite supply contribute to its popularity as a hedge against inflation.

However, investing in gold is not without its considerations. Its price can be volatile and affected by a range of elements, including global economic conditions, monetary policy, and investor behavior. Before making any investment decisions, it's crucial to conduct thorough research and develop a well-informed plan of action that aligns with your financial goals.
